China welcomes 29.2 million visitors in 11 months
BEIJING -- China has welcomed 29.218 million visitors during the first 11 months of 2024. Of these, 17.446 million visitors entered the country without visas, marking a 123.3% increase compared to the same period last year. UAE Introduces New Pricing Policy for Essential Goods to Protect Consumers and Promote Market Stability
The UAE Ministry of Economy has announced a new pricing policy for nine essential consumer goods, including cooking oil, eggs, dairy, rice, sugar, poultry, legumes, bread, and wheat.
